It helps with things like diagnosing illnesses and running hospitals. For example, big health systems in Central Florida, like AdventHealth and Orlando Health, use AI in more than 40 different ways. These include spotting diseases early and managing patients who stay at home. By December 2023, the U.S. Food and Drug Administration (FDA) had approved 692 AI devices for medical use. This shows that AI is growing fast in the country.<\/p>\n<p>In real use, AI can do simple jobs. It can record and write down doctor appointments, make clinical notes, and check patients\u2019 vital signs remotely. This helps reduce the work for healthcare workers, who are often short-staffed. It lets doctors and nurses spend more time with their patients. AI has helped, for example, by lowering deaths from sepsis by 44%, according to a 2023 study on AI tools for detecting sepsis.<\/p>\n<p>But there are still problems. Studies show that AI is not always accurate. A sepsis-detection AI at the University of Michigan found sepsis in only half the cases. Also, some AI models, like ChatGPT-4 tested by Stanford, gave correct medical advice just 41% of the time. Some answers even included made-up citations, called \u201challucinations.\u201d These issues make people doubtful and less willing to trust AI in healthcare.<\/p>\n<h2>Addressing Bias and Inaccuracies to Build Trust<\/h2>\n<p>Bias and mistakes in AI usually come from old or limited training data. Sometimes there are not enough checks while the AI is working. These problems can lead to wrong or unfair medical decisions. For example, Amazon had a hiring AI that was unfair to women because it learned from past biased hiring. Healthcare AI can have the same kind of problem if the data lack diversity or reflect past inequalities.<\/p>\n<p>Health administrators and IT managers must make sure AI is trained on fresh and varied data that covers all kinds of patients. Independent groups should check these systems often to find and fix bias. For example, AdventHealth has an AI Advisory Board that meets every month to review new AI tools and watch those already used.<\/p>\n<p>It is also important to have safety controls in place. These include settings that flag unusual results and records that track how AI made decisions. Some AI can learn continuously from new data without causing mistakes. These steps help prevent errors that could hurt patients and reduce trust.<\/p>\n<p>Being open about how AI works also helps people trust it. Microsoft shows how AI makes decisions by giving tools that explain the process. Protecting this data is very important. Hospitals must use methods like encryption, strict access rules, using only needed information, and making data anonymous. These steps lower the chance that personal info is leaked or misused, which could harm people and break laws like HIPAA.<\/p>\n<p>Regular checks make sure that systems follow privacy rules and stay secure. Healthcare providers should talk clearly with patients about how their data is used and protect their rights. Starting with small projects in safer areas lets managers test AI, collect real data on how it works, and get feedback from users. This way, they can fix problems before using AI more widely. It helps avoid too much disruption and builds trust as people see it works.<\/p>\n<p>Feedback is very important to catch errors or bias quickly. Constantly watching AI results helps find mistakes early so they can be fixed fast. Feedback loops, like those in language and learning AI models, let AI improve based on user interaction. This constant fixing makes AI more reliable and better aligned with ethical values.<\/p>\n<p>Healthcare leaders should set up ways for doctors, nurses, and patients to report problems or unusual results fast.
